A 27-year-old Russian-Australian man has been charged with foreign interference by the Australian Federal Police (AFP). He was arrested on August 18, 2026, in Brisbane's southwest and is a resident of Victoria. The charges stem from an investigation by the AFP's counter foreign interference task force. The man is set to appear in Brisbane Magistrates Court on August 21, 2026. The AFP has indicated that further details will be provided in a press conference later today. This incident highlights ongoing concerns about foreign influence in Australian affairs.
